Kenny Wallace is mentioned by Faye Whitaker in strip 502. He was a long-term school friend, with whom she lost her virginity. She mentions talking to her father about it, although Kenny is not actually pictured. He at some point owned a goldfish and a Buick.

  • Kenny is the youngest of three brothers, and racing was well known within his household before any of them were old enough to drive. Their father, Russ Wallace was a formidable racer on the local dirt tracks, and it was in part Russ’s early success that earned Kenny his familiar nickname, “Herman.” Russ won over 400 races in those days, and is often the case in racing, winning a lot made him unpopular among a number of fans. Young Kenny took exception to the unkind words said about his dad, and often took matters into his own hands with whatever means were available, meaning, on at least one occasion, snowcones.
